Saccharin was learned in 1879 by Constantine Fahlberg, when Operating within the laboratory of Ira Remsen, pretty accidentally as have been most other sweeteners. While Doing the job in the lab, he spilled a chemical on his hand. Later though taking in meal, Fahlberg found a more sweetness while in the bread he was ingesting.

Some animal exploration some many years in the past connected saccharin with feasible health issues, bringing about a decrease inside the substance’s level of popularity. Nonetheless, later experiments in human beings didn't affirm a website link to cancer.

The FDA assesses the protection of a sweetener by assessing the out there security details about the sweetener to recognize possible hazards and decide a safe amount of exposure. Through pre-industry evaluation, the FDA set up an acceptable day by day ingestion (ADI) stage for every from the six sweeteners authorised as foods additives. An ADI is the quantity of a material thought of Safe and sound to read more take in day after day over the program of a person’s life span.
